
Odisha CM Applauds National Topper Awardees from State’s ITIs
Bhubaneswar: Odisha Chief Minister Mohan Charan Majhi extended heartfelt congratulations to Pramod Dalpati and Jitendra Pradhan, two outstanding students from the state who were honoured with the prestigious ‘All India Topper Award 2025’ at the Kaushal Deekshant Samaroh held in New Delhi.
Pramod Dalpati, representing Government ITI Phulbani in Kandhamal district, secured top honours in the Electronics Mechanic trade.
Jitendra Pradhan, an alumnus of Government ITI Hinjilicut in Ganjam and currently pursuing studies at NSTI Bhubaneswar, emerged as the national topper in the Electrician trade.
The Chief Minister praised their achievements, stating that their success reflects the strength of Odisha’s vocational training ecosystem and brings pride to the state.
He emphasised the role of skill development in empowering youth and positioning Odisha as a hub for technical excellence.
